What Does Brushed Aluminum Mean?

Simply put, brushed aluminum refers to ordinary aluminum or aluminum alloy that undergoes a mechanical brushing finish treatment on its surface.

 

It is not a new type of aluminum material. Brushed aluminum is still pure aluminum or standard aluminum alloy; the only difference is its surface texture. Manufacturers use abrasive belts, grinding wheels, or wire brushes to create uniform linear grain lines on the aluminum surface, forming a matte, textured brushed effect.

 

In short:

  • Base material = Aluminum / Aluminum alloy
  • Surface treatment = Mechanical wire drawing / brushing
  • Final result = Brushed aluminum finish

 

This definition is the standard explanation used in the metal fabrication, hardware, electronics, and construction industries worldwide.

 

How Is Brushed Aluminum Made?

To understand what brushed aluminum means, it is important to know its production process:

  1. Surface Polishing: Raw aluminum sheets or parts are first polished to remove burrs, scratches, and impurities.
  2. Mechanical Brushing: Professional abrasive tools create continuous linear grain in one fixed direction, forming classic brushed lines.
  3. Degreasing & Cleaning: Remove dust and oil left by the brushing process.
  4. Anodization or Coating: Many brushed aluminum products add an anodized layer or protective coating to enhance corrosion resistance and fix the brushed texture.
  5. Final Inspection: Check texture uniformity, color consistency, and surface quality before delivery.

 

The whole process changes only the appearance and surface performance, without altering the internal metal composition of aluminum.

 

Key Characteristics of Brushed Aluminum

Now that you know what brushed aluminum means, let's look at its core characteristics that make it so popular:

 

1. Unique Matte Linear Texture

  • Brushed aluminum features delicate parallel grain lines, creating a low-gloss, non-reflective matte look. It is softer and more understated than polished mirror aluminum, bringing a high-end industrial and minimalist aesthetic.

 

2. Excellent Fingerprint & Smudge Resistance

  • The brushed grain structure can effectively hide fingerprints, oil stains, and daily dust. Unlike smooth aluminum that shows every mark, brushed aluminum stays clean-looking with minimal wiping.

 

3. Conceals Minor Scratches

  • Small daily scratches and wear can blend naturally into the brushed lines, greatly extending the service life and appearance retention of aluminum parts.

 

4. Good Corrosion Resistance

  • After brushing and anodizing treatment, brushed aluminum has strong anti-rust and anti-corrosion ability, suitable for indoor and outdoor environments.

 

5. Lightweight & Easy to Process

  • Aluminum itself is lightweight and easy to cut, bend, stamp, and fabricate. The brushed finish does not affect its machinability, making it ideal for customized sheet metal parts.

 

6. Low Maintenance

  • Brushed aluminum does not require frequent polishing. Daily wiping with a soft cloth is enough to maintain its original texture.

 

Common Types of Brushed Aluminum Finishes

When people ask what brushed aluminum means, they often do not know there are different categories:

  1. Linear Brushed Aluminum: Straight parallel grain, the most common type, widely used in hardware and electronics.
  2. Cross Brushed Aluminum: Grain lines cross each other, presenting a special textured effect for high-end decoration.
  3. Satin Brushed Aluminum: Ultra-fine grain, softer matte feeling, popular for luxury furniture and appliances.
  4. Vertical / Horizontal Brushed Aluminum: Classified by grain direction to match different design needs.

 

Each type has the same base aluminum material, only differing in surface brushing style.

 

Main Applications of Brushed Aluminum

Brushed aluminum is one of the most widely used metal finishes across industries:

  • Electronics & Appliances: Laptop shells, TV frames, electrical panel covers, PCB accessory parts
  • Furniture Hardware: Long metal hinges, 72 inch stainless steel piano hinges, cabinet handles, door fittings
  • Architectural Decoration: Wall panels, ceiling materials, curtain wall aluminum profiles
  • Automotive Parts: Interior trim, decorative strips, lightweight structural parts
  • Industrial Sheet Metal: Custom prototype sheet metal stamping, mechanical equipment shells
  • Daily Consumer Goods: Lighting fixtures, kitchen utensils, decorative metal parts

Brushed Aluminum vs Brushed Brass / Brushed Nickel

Many people confuse brushed aluminum with other brushed metals.

 

Here is a simple comparison:

  • Brushed Aluminum: Lightweight, low cost, silver-gray tone, best for large panels and lightweight parts
  • Brushed Brass: Warm golden color, heavier, mainly used for high-end hardware and decorative parts
  • Brushed Nickel: Silvery white tone, higher corrosion resistance, common in bathroom and kitchen hardware

 

Knowing the difference helps you select the right material for your project.

How to Maintain Brushed Aluminum

To keep brushed aluminum looking new for years:

  1. Wipe regularly with a soft dry microfiber cloth.
  2. Use mild neutral detergent mixed with water for heavy dirt.
  3. Avoid abrasive steel wool and strong acidic cleaners.
  4. Always wipe along the brushed grain direction, not across it.

 

Simple daily maintenance can keep brushed aluminum intact for decades.
